PILMAN Posted May 23, 2006 Report Share Posted May 23, 2006 Pilman, tell me how that IDF vest works out for you. I've been looking in to getting one for a while now. <{POST_SNAPBACK}> It seems to be pretty comfortable especially in the heat, plenty of pouches and it's definitely good while in the prone position. It works well while crawling too. You can adjust the shoulder straps from the pouches too and the things built like a rock so no worrys beating the ###### out of the thing. I'd say the only downside is the vest isn't actually modular (most IDF custom build their vests and sew on pouches) other than that it's definitely an overlooked vest though it definitely ranks up there with the higher end stuff.
